Presented at Luxe Pack Monaco, ERA™ reflects Silgan Dispensing’s commitment to premium and sustainable packaging. This fully plastic solution is now being applied to DNA™ airless systems.

Silgan Dispensing reaffirms its commitment to cosmetic packaging that combines functional excellence with environmental responsibility. The group continues to develop high-end dispensing systems that protect formulas, enhance consumer experience, and enable large-scale recyclability.

The ERA™ platform was launched at Luxe Pack Monaco in 2025, with formats dedicated to facial care and sun care applications (35 mm and 40 mm tube diameters).

At Paris Packaging Week 2026, ERA™ expands its applications:

Silgan Dispensing is using PPW 2026 to introduce two major ERA™ extensions.

The first concerns the DNA™ airless range, one of Silgan’s most emblematic products, suitable for facial serums and creams. Available in 30 ml, 40 ml, and 50 ml formats, DNA 35ERA™ retains its premium aesthetics while meeting future regulatory requirements.

DNA 35ERA™ combines the key attributes brands expect, within an eco-design approach:

  • Smooth and controlled actuation
  • Compatibility with the most demanding formulations
  • Precise dosing
  • Optimal formula protection thanks to airless technology
  • Recyclability within polyolefin streams

In addition, the ERA™ airless design ensures a formula evacuation rate above 95%, helping limit product waste and reduce overall packaging waste.

The second extension adapts ERA™ to small-capacity cosmetic tubes: 25 mm and 30 mm diameters, intended for liquid makeup and targeted treatments such as eye contour applications.

The LifeCycle™ breakthrough

ERA™ integrates Silgan Dispensing’s patented LifeCycle™ technology. This major innovation replaces metal springs with plastic equivalents to ensure recyclability.
